The cheapest way to get from Algar to Faro is to bus which costs €40 - €85 and takes 6h 34m.
The fastest way to get from Algar to Faro is to drive which takes 3h 35m and costs €45 - €70.
No, there is no direct bus from Algar to Faro. However, there are services departing from Estación de Autobuses de Arcos de la Frontera and arriving at Faro via Jerez de la Frontera.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 6h 34m.
The distance between Algar and Faro is 359 km. The road distance is 298 km.
The best way to get from Algar to Faro without a car is to train and bus which takes 6h 31m and costs €45 - €90.
It takes approximately 6h 31m to get from Algar to Faro, including transfers.
Algar to Faro bus services, operated by Rede Expressos, depart from Jerez de la Frontera station.
Algar to Faro bus services, operated by Rede Expressos, arrive at Faro station.
Faro is 1h behind Algar. It is currently 7:58 PM in Algar and 6:58 PM in Faro.
Yes, the driving distance between Algar to Faro is 298 km. It takes approximately 3h 35m to drive from Algar to Faro.
